What are the differences between irons used in our products?


What is steel?

Steel is an alloy made up of iron and carbon.


What is Corten steel?

Corten is a steel with added phosphorus, copper, chromium, and nickel-molybdenum.  These added components increase the steels resistance to atmospheric corrosion because they create a protective patina on the surface.  


What is mild steel?

Mild steel is a ferrous metal made from Iron and carbon.  Mild steel is recyclable.  It does not have a high resistance to corrosion in its untreated form, but this can be improved by applying a surface protection product to the exposed parts.


What is cast iron?

Cast iron is a group of iron-carbon alloys with a high carbon content.  It also contains silicon.  Cast iron has a low melting point, has good fluidity/castability and excellent machinability.  It is resistant to deformation and wear.  However, it tends to be brittle. Pig ironmost commonly used form of cast iron, is an intermediate product of the iron industry in the production of steel.  It has a very high carbon content along with silica and other constituents of dross which makes it very brittle.  The Chinese have been making it since the later part of the Zhou dynasty, which ended in 256BC!


What is wrought iron?

Wrought iron is an iron alloy with a very low carbon content. It has a small amount of silicate slag and consists of around 99.4% of iron by mass.   It is tough, malleable, corrosion resistant and easily forge welded.
